Ireland - Diesel Oil Final Consumption in Chemical and Petrochemical Sectors

Since 2014, Ireland Diesel Oil Final Consumption in Chemical and Petrochemical Sectors decreased by 10.8% year on year. At 54.34 Gigawatthours in 2019, the country was number 11 among other countries in Diesel Oil Final Consumption in Chemical and Petrochemical Sectors. Ireland is overtaken by Finland, which was ranked number 10 at 59.69 Gigawatthours and is followed by Austria with 53.2 Gigawatthours. Italy topped the ranking with 1,396.27 Gigawatthours in 2019, a fall of 4.8% compared to 2018. United Kingdom, Poland and Spain resp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Austria witnessed the best average annual growth at +60.2% per year, while Greece was the worst growing country at -46% per year.
